Paulson leads BYU to shutout win over Saint Mary's

MORAGA, Calif. – Sophomore pitcher Arissa Paulson led BYU to a 7-0 shutout of Saint Mary’s on Friday afternoon at Cottrell Field.

“It was a good win today,” BYU head coach Gordon Eakin said. “Arissa Paulson pitched a great game today and also set the tone offensively with a two-run shot in the first inning. Tomorrow we just need to execute better with runners in scoring position.”

Game Highlights:

  • The Cougars (25-21, 9-1 WCC) held the Gaels (11-35, 4-6 WCC) scoreless in the first game of the series. It was the sixth shutout game this season for BYU.
  • Arissa Paulson tallied her 13th win this season with a complete game and her third shutout in the last two weeks while also hitting a home run during the game.
  • Rylee Jensen, Arissa Paulson and Olivia Sanchez all drove in runners during the game.

Player Highlights:

  • Arissa Paulson: W (13-9), 7.0 IP, 8 H, 0R, 2 K
  • Olivia Sanchez: 3-4, 2 RBI, 2B
  • Arissa Paulson: 1-2, 2R, 1 HR, 2 RBI
  • Lexi Tarrow: 3-4, 1 SB

The Cougars got on the board in the top of the first inning. Williams singled to left field and then advanced to second on a wild pitch. An Arissa Paulson homer just inside the left foul pole gave BYU a 2-0 lead to start the game.

In the top of the third, Libby Sugg singled up the middle and Brooke Hill subbed in as a pinch runner. Paulson and Erickson both reached to load the bases before Olivia Sanchez lined a ball to center field to clear the bases for a 5-0 lead.

BYU tacked on two more runs in the top seventh inning. Allie Hancock, as a pinch runner, and Marissa Chavez made it home as Jensen reached on an infield single. The Cougars held the Gaels scoreless in the bottom of the seventh and BYU took the win 7-0.

BYU finishes up the series against Saint Mary’s with a doubleheader Saturday, May 4. The first game starts at 12 p.m. followed by the second game at 2 p.m. PT. Live stats will be on the schedule page.
